I bought a couple of cases when it first hit the market and used as Xmas gifts to my employees. I have loved this winery since my first visit in 1990's. I had laid away one of the bottles and opened this afternoon, a chilly winter's day in Texas. It still has a lingering Granny Smith Apple taste, slightly acid but reminiscent of its first taste these many years ago. It has aged well.

Bought this on sale, and wish I could find more. An excellent example of Firestone's origin - even if you don't typically drink the sweet varietals, you'll most likely enjoy this one. Savor with spicy food for best results. $13 - 15 per bottle, great value - I'll be hunting more of this wine down. Drink soon, or lay down for a few years - either way you won't be disappointed.

6/16/2009 - J_Hayden wrote: 86 Points
Gold yellow color with honeysuckle nose. Grapefruit with some pepper and soap on palate. Nice.
